Fire breaks out at historic building in Menasha; 3 firefighters injured

MENASHA -- A historic building caught fire in Menasha and it took crews about ten hours to put it out.

The flames started on the roof of the Brin Building around 5:30 p.m. Friday, Aug. 10.

The Brin Building dates back a century. It was an entertainment hub in the community since 1908.

Currently, there are six apartments in the building. Ten people were displaced. The Red Cross is providing assistance.



Three firefighters suffered minor injuries; two from smoke inhalation and one from a fall. They're all expected to be OK.

The fire started in the attic. It was finally put out around 3:30 a.m. Saturday. The cause is still under investigation.
